function cargainicialprincial(){
	cargareditorial();
	carganoticias(2, 1);
	carganoticias(1, 1);
	cargar_calendario();
	carga_eventospri();
	carga_foro();
}

function cargainicialnoticiasint(tipo){
	var param="tipo="+tipo;
	url="php/noticiasint.php";
	objAjax = new crearAjax();
	clsAjax = new claseAjax();
	clsAjax.iniciarAjax (objAjax, url , param, 1, "caja_noticias_interiores");
}

function cargareditorial(){
	var param="";
	url="php/editorial.php";
	objAjax = new crearAjax();
	clsAjax = new claseAjax();
	clsAjax.iniciarAjax (objAjax, url , param, 1, "noticia_editorial");
}

function carganoticias(tipo, pag){
	if(pag*1<=0){
		pag = 1;
	}
	var param="tipo="+tipo+"&pag="+pag;
	url="php/listadonoticiasprincipal.php";
	objAjax = new crearAjax();
	clsAjax = new claseAjax();
	if(tipo==2){
		clsAjax.iniciarAjax (objAjax, url , param, 1, "titulares_noticias_institucion");
	}
	if(tipo==1){
		clsAjax.iniciarAjax (objAjax, url , param, 1, "titulares_noticias_generales");
	}
}

function cargar_calendario(ano, mes){
	var param="ano="+ano+"&mes="+mes;
	url="../../hospital/ajax/cal/ret_cal_mensual.php";
	objAjax = new crearAjax();
	clsAjax = new claseAjax();
	clsAjax.iniciarAjax (objAjax, url , param, 1, "cal_index");
}

function carga_foro(){
	var param="";
	url="php/ver_preguntaforo.php";
	objAjax = new crearAjax();
	clsAjax = new claseAjax();
	clsAjax.iniciarAjax (objAjax, url , param, 1, "texto_banner_foro");
}

function carga_eventospri(){
	var param="";
	url="php/listeventos1.php";
	objAjax = new crearAjax();
	clsAjax = new claseAjax();
	clsAjax.iniciarAjax (objAjax, url , param, 1, "tablacal");
}

function abrirdia(dia, mes, ano){
	var fecha = ano+'-'+mes+'-' + dia;
	var pag = "php/ver_evento.php?dia=" + fecha;
	abrirPagevento(pag);
//	alert(dia + '-' + mes + '-' + ano)
}

function abrirPagevento(pag){
	var nombre = '';
	var caract = 'scrollbars=no, width=600, height=600, left=100, top=50';
	abrirEmerg(pag,nombre,caract);
}

function ins_comentario(foro){
	var comentario = document.getElementById("comentario").value;
	var usuario    = document.getElementById("nombre_comentarista").value;
	var email      = document.getElementById("correo_comentarista").value;
	var param      = "foro="+foro+"&comentario="+comentario+"&usuario="+usuario+"&email="+email;
        if(valcorreo(email)){
            url="ins_comentario.php";
            //alert(param);
            objAjax = new crearAjax();
            clsAjax = new claseAjax();
            clsAjax.iniciarAjax (objAjax, url , param, 0, "iracomentarios");
        }
}
function iracomentarios(obj) {
    var pk= unescape(obj);
    location="participeforo.php?foro="+pk;
}

function carga_listforos(){
	var param="";
	url="php/listforos1.php";
	objAjax = new crearAjax();
	clsAjax = new claseAjax();
	clsAjax.iniciarAjax (objAjax, url , param, 1, "caja_tabla_documentacion");
}


function validarEmail(valor) {
    if (/^\w+([\.-]?\w+)*@\w+([\.-]?\w+)*(\.\w{2,3,4})+$/.test(valor)){
        return true;
    } else {
        alert("La direcci&oacute;n de email es incorrecta.");
        return false
    }
}

function valcorreo(valor) {
    if (/^((([a-z]|\d|[!#\$%&'\*\+\-\/=\?\^_`{\|}~]|[\u00A0-\uD7FF\uF900-\uFDCF\uFDF0-\uFFEF])+(\.([a-z]|\d|[!#\$%&'\*\+\-\/=\?\^_`{\|}~]|[\u00A0-\uD7FF\uF900-\uFDCF\uFDF0-\uFFEF])+)*)|((\x22)((((\x20|\x09)*(\x0d\x0a))?(\x20|\x09)+)?(([\x01-\x08\x0b\x0c\x0e-\x1f\x7f]|\x21|[\x23-\x5b]|[\x5d-\x7e]|[\u00A0-\uD7FF\uF900-\uFDCF\uFDF0-\uFFEF])|(\\([\x01-\x09\x0b\x0c\x0d-\x7f]|[\u00A0-\uD7FF\uF900-\uFDCF\uFDF0-\uFFEF]))))*(((\x20|\x09)*(\x0d\x0a))?(\x20|\x09)+)?(\x22)))@((([a-z]|\d|[\u00A0-\uD7FF\uF900-\uFDCF\uFDF0-\uFFEF])|(([a-z]|\d|[\u00A0-\uD7FF\uF900-\uFDCF\uFDF0-\uFFEF])([a-z]|\d|-|\.|_|~|[\u00A0-\uD7FF\uF900-\uFDCF\uFDF0-\uFFEF])*([a-z]|\d|[\u00A0-\uD7FF\uF900-\uFDCF\uFDF0-\uFFEF])))\.)+(([a-z]|[\u00A0-\uD7FF\uF900-\uFDCF\uFDF0-\uFFEF])|(([a-z]|[\u00A0-\uD7FF\uF900-\uFDCF\uFDF0-\uFFEF])([a-z]|\d|-|\.|_|~|[\u00A0-\uD7FF\uF900-\uFDCF\uFDF0-\uFFEF])*([a-z]|[\u00A0-\uD7FF\uF900-\uFDCF\uFDF0-\uFFEF])))\.?$/.test(valor)){
        return (true)
    } else {
        alert("El email es incorrecto.");
        return (false);
    }
}

function ordenarForo(){
	var ord = document.getElementById('ordenForo').value;
	var param="orden="+ord;
	url="php/listforos1.php";
	objAjax = new crearAjax();
	clsAjax = new claseAjax();
	clsAjax.iniciarAjax (objAjax, url , param, 1, "caja_tabla_documentacion");
}

function ordenarcontratos(){
	var ord = document.getElementById('ordencont').value;
	var param="orden="+ord;
	url="php/listacontratos.php";
	objAjax = new crearAjax();
	clsAjax = new claseAjax();
	clsAjax.iniciarAjax (objAjax, url , param, 1, "caja_tabla_documentacion");
}

function ordenarsalas(){
	var ord = document.getElementById('ordencont').value;
	var param="orden="+ord;
	url="php/listsalas.php";
	objAjax = new crearAjax();
	clsAjax = new claseAjax();
	clsAjax.iniciarAjax (objAjax, url , param, 1, "caja_tabla_documentacion");
}